Latest Patents

Dariusz Stramski holds a patent for a Nanoparticle Analyzer. This invention involves methods for detecting and analyzing individual nanoparticles of varying sizes co-existing in a fluid sample using multi-spectral analysis. The technology utilizes multiple light sources to produce beams at different spectral wavebands. An optical assembly combines these light beams into incident light sheets that illuminate nanoparticles in a liquid sample. Image detectors are then employed to detect light scattered or emitted by the nanoparticles across various wavelengths.
